Background technology
Currently, the plastic uptake product such as pallet, vacuum formed box is since Forming Quality is good, manufacturing cost is low etc., advantages are answered extensively
For in the industries such as electronics, food.The production procedure of traditional plastic uptake product is substantially:Sawing sheet man-handling of materials → labelling → people
Work transhipment → machine milling type → man-handling of materials → sanding/glue spraying → man-handling of materials → craft wobble plate → plastic uptake → cleaning → completion.
However the traditional processing technology has the disadvantage that:The factor of man-handling of materials is excessive, cause product different manufacturing procedures it
Between turnaround speed it is slow, extreme influence production efficiency, while hand labor intensity is big, human cost expenditure is high.

In the above-described embodiments, the panel turnover machine 330 includes engine base, the overturning actuator being set on the engine base, sets
The turning guide rail being placed on the engine base, the transmission for being set on the turning guide rail and being drivingly connected with the overturning actuator
Chain and be set on the turning guide rail and with the roll-over table of the transmission chain link.It can so realize that plastic uptake product determines angle
Degree, high-precision attitude overturning, it is ensured that the product form after overturning meets processing technology requirement, it is ensured that product processing quality.Specifically
, above-mentioned overturning actuator is motor, is set with gear on the output shaft of motor, and transmission chain is preferably chain, by with
Rotation is realized in the engagement of gear, and then roll-over table is driven to rotate synchronously;Specific flip angle is controlled by PLC controller, specifically
It is that the turnning circle correspondence of output shaft is converted to flip angle angle value.For example, the corresponding transmission chain of one circle of output shaft rotation rotates 5
Degree then needs to turn over when turning 90 degrees, and corresponding output shaft needs 14 circle of rotation.

On the basis of the above embodiments, further include code reader 700, the code reader 700 is set to the panel turnover machine 330
It is communicated to connect between the first numerical control milling type machine 310 and with the control device.In actual processing, some plastic uptake products
It only needs to process one side, and some plastic uptake products need two-sided processing, at this time in order to improve the production efficiency of system, it is sometimes desirable to
Said two products are seated in process line simultaneously, to improve product identification ability, single or double processing can be selected in
Identification code is made on product, such as can be Quick Response Code, bar code etc., and the identification code information is correspondingly input to control device
In code reader 700.So when being contaminated with the product of different processing requests on production line, code reader 700 can be to plastic uptake
Whether product needs to carry out turnover panel progress intelligent recognition, it is ensured that system meets the processing needs to different product, ensures that product adds
Working medium amount, lifting system processing performance.
